Understanding Project Lifecycle Integration
A successful project isn’t just about completing tasks; it's about navigating a well-defined lifecycle. That lifecycle typically includes initiation, planning, execution, monitoring & controlling, and closure. Effective project management software provides tools for each of these stages. Initiation involves defining the project’s scope and objectives and securing necessary approvals. Planning focuses on creating a detailed roadmap outlining tasks, timelines, resources, and potential risks. The execution phase is where the work gets done, and constant monitoring and controlling ensures the project stays on track. Finally, project closure formally completes the project, documenting lessons learned and archiving relevant materials. A platform truly designed for project success will encompass and support all these phases.
The Role of Communication in Project Success
Central to the success of any project is clear and consistent communication. Miscommunication or a lack of transparency can quickly derail even the most meticulously planned initiatives. Modern project management solutions often provide integrated communication tools such as instant messaging, discussion forums, and file sharing capabilities. These features allow team members to stay connected, share updates, and address issues promptly. Furthermore, effective communication extends beyond internal collaboration to include stakeholders, providing them with regular progress reports and soliciting their feedback throughout the project lifecycle. Tools that facilitate open dialogue and information sharing build trust and prevent misunderstandings.
| Project Phase | Key Communication Activities |
|---|---|
| Initiation | Stakeholder briefing, project kickoff meeting. |
| Planning | Task assignment confirmation, risk assessment sharing. |
| Execution | Daily stand-ups, progress updates, issue reporting. |
| Monitoring & Controlling | Performance reports, status meetings, corrective action plans. |
Integrating communication directly into the project management tool allows for a single source of truth, reducing the risk of information silos and ensuring everyone is on the same page. This structured approach to communication significantly increases the likelihood of project success and minimizes the potential for costly errors or delays.

Streamlining Workflow Automation and Resource Management
Workflow automation is a game-changer for project management. By automating repetitive tasks, teams can free up valuable time and resources to focus on more strategic initiatives. For example, task assignments, status updates, and report generation can all be automated, reducing the need for manual intervention. Resource management is another critical aspect of successful project management. Platforms provide tools for tracking employee availability, allocating resources effectively, and identifying potential bottlenecks. These capabilities are especially important for complex projects with multiple dependencies and a large number of team members. Effective resource management ensures that the right people are working on the right tasks at the right time, maximizing productivity and minimizing costs.
Integrating with Existing Tools and Systems
A versatile project management platform seamlessly integrates with other tools and systems that teams already use, such as CRM, accounting software, and communication platforms like Slack or Microsoft Teams. This integration eliminates the need for manual data entry and ensures that information is consistent across all systems. For example, integrating a project management tool with a CRM system allows teams to track project-related activities directly within the customer record, providing a 360-degree view of the customer relationship. Similarly, integrating with accounting software simplifies project budgeting and expense tracking. The ability to connect with existing tools maximizes the value of the project management platform and minimizes disruption to established workflows.
- Define integration requirements and identify compatible tools.
- Configure the integration settings and map data fields.
- Test the integration thoroughly to ensure data accuracy.
- Train team members on how to use the integrated system.
- Monitor the integration regularly and address any issues that arise.
Successful integration minimizes data silos, streamlines workflows and enhances overall operational efficiency. Choosing a platform with robust integration capabilities is a key consideration when selecting a project management solution.
Measuring Project Performance and Generating Insights
Data-driven decision-making is crucial for continuous improvement in project management. Robust platforms offer a range of reporting and analytics features that provide valuable insights into project performance. Key performance indicators (KPIs) such as task completion rates, budget adherence, and resource utilization can be tracked over time. This data can be used to identify areas for improvement, optimize workflows, and enhance team productivity. Visual dashboards and customizable reports provide a clear and concise overview of project status. Furthermore, data analytics can help identify patterns and trends that might not be apparent through traditional reporting methods. This understanding then become an asset for making proactive adjustments and preventing potential issues.
Analyzing historical project data helps teams learn from past successes and failures. By understanding what worked well and what didn't, organizations can refine their processes and improve their chances of success in future projects. This continuous cycle of measurement, analysis, and improvement is essential for maximizing the return on investment in project management initiatives.
